See list of top 10 highest-paid sportsmen in the world

Following Cristiano Ronaldo’s big money move to Saudi-based Al Nasir which made him the highest-paid sportsman in the world, Sporting Tribune brings you the list of highest-paid sportsmen in the world according to consultancy and ratings firm DBRS Morningstar.

Here is a list of the 10 highest-paid sportsmen in the world

10 – Max Verstappen

       

        Team: Red Bull Racing

        Sport: Formula 1

        Salary: 43.3m euros

 

9 – Kirk Cousins

      Team: Minnesota Vikings

      Sport: American Football

      Salary: 43.3m euros

 

8 – Deshaun Watson

      Team: Cleveland Browns

      Sport- American Football

      Salary: 52.3m euros

7 – Lewis Hamilton

      Team: Mercedes

      Sport: Formula 1

      Salary: 53.7m euros

 

6- Aaron Rodgers

     Team: Green Bay Packers

     Sport: American Football

     Salary: 53.7m euros

 

5 – Josh Allen

      Team: Buffalo Bills

      Sport: NFL

      Salary: 59.3m euros

 

4 – Matthew Stafford

      Team: Los Angeles Rams

      Sport: NFL

      Salary: 65.7m euros

 

3 – Neymar

      Team: PSG

      Sport: Football

      Salary: 65.9m euros

 

2 – Lionel Messi

      Team: PSG

      Sport: Football

      Salary: 70.6m euros

 

1 – Cristiano Ronaldo

      Team: Al Nassr

      Sport: Football

      Salary: 112.1m euros
